What are you thirsting for in life?

42:02 Psalm “My soul thirsts for God, for the living God. When can I go and meet with God?” (NIV)

Someone once told me about the rules of 3 in staying alive: Three minutes without air. Three days without water. Three weeks without food. Yet, we also need to be reminded that we are ALL only one heartbeat away from eternity… we are ALL just that close to meeting God. So, as thirst is something we need to take care of often each day, we should also thirst after His Word in our lives often each day.
